Introduction
Transforming Mental Health Support Through Collaboration
The Multidisciplinary Approach to Mental Health Training Programme is a structured capacity-building initiative designed for healthcare professionals, educators, social workers, and justice sector workers. This training is part of the EU-PROMENS initiative, aimed to:
- promote a multidisciplinary approach to mental health support by equipping diverse professionals with the competencies needed to collaborate effectively across sectors.
- foster a shared understanding of mental health, enhance teamwork, and build capacity for integrated, person-centred care that addresses mental health challenges holistically.
- create a cohesive, multidisciplinary network of professionals who can work together effectively to deliver comprehensive, person-centred mental health prevention and care that improves outcomes for individuals and communities.

What you will learn?
The programme is structured around the Cross-Sectoral Mental Health Competencies Framework and covers:
🟢 Mental Health Literacy – Understanding mental health, risk factors, and intervention strategies.
🟢 Assessment & Risk Identification – How to assess mental health concerns and navigate support systems.
🟢 Referrals & System Navigation – Learn how to guide individuals through complex mental health services.
🟢 Interdisciplinary Collaboration – Work effectively with professionals from different sectors.
🟢 Self-Care & Team Support – Strategies for maintaining mental well-being in high-stress environments.
